$203 million proposal on ballot in Cherry Creek (Colo.) district

Sept. 22, 2008
Money would pay for 3 elementary schools and numerous renovations

TheCherry Creek (Colo.) district is asking voters in November to approve a $203 million bond proposal. The money would enable the district to build three elementary schools; renovate 14 elementary schools, two middle schools, and two high schools; and upgrade wiring, fire protection, heating, air conditioning and plumbing systems at 50 schools and other facilities.
